4 Marketing Trends That Point Toward the Importance of SEO

Online marketing was once a straightforward affair. All you needed was a list of e-mails on the one hand and a product to sell on the other. The advent of web 2.0 changed the online interaction patterns. Search engines flourished into full-fledged businesses, and the online marketplace became too valuable for any industry player to ignore. Below are four marketing trends that point toward the importance of SEO as a marketing strategy that prosperity conscious organization cannot afford to ignore.

Indexation Sculpting

If you thought that you could use black hat or dubious SEO techniques to make money, then you’re in for a shocker. The tricks do not work anymore, and even if they do, it is just a matter of time before your site is penalized by the search engines for SEO malpractices. The rules governing the SEO industry are getting tougher, and this is pushing up the industry’s value. SEO quality assessment techniques such as indexation sculpting are making it difficult for anyone to take up the title “SEO expert” and this is changing the public perception on the industry – giving it the knack and the significance to drive the next generation marketing endeavors.
